 26 package jdk.internal.reflect;
 27 
 28 import java.lang.invoke.MethodHandle;
 29 import java.lang.invoke.MethodType;
 30 import java.lang.reflect.Field;
 31 import java.lang.reflect.Modifier;
 32 
 33 class MethodHandleFloatFieldAccessorImpl extends MethodHandleFieldAccessorImpl {
 34     static FieldAccessorImpl fieldAccessor(Field field, MethodHandle getter, MethodHandle setter, boolean isReadOnly) {
 35         boolean isStatic = Modifier.isStatic(field.getModifiers());
 36         if (isStatic) {
 37             getter = getter.asType(MethodType.methodType(float.class));
 38             if (setter != null) {
 39                 setter = setter.asType(MethodType.methodType(void.class, float.class));
 40             }
 41         } else {
 42             getter = getter.asType(MethodType.methodType(float.class, Object.class));
 43             if (setter != null) {
 44                 setter = setter.asType(MethodType.methodType(void.class, Object.class, float.class));
 45             }
 46         }
 47         return new MethodHandleFloatFieldAccessorImpl(field, getter, setter, isReadOnly, isStatic);
 48     }
 49 
 50     MethodHandleFloatFieldAccessorImpl(Field field, MethodHandle getter, MethodHandle setter, boolean isReadOnly, boolean isStatic) {
 51         super(field, getter, setter, isReadOnly, isStatic);
 52     }
 53 
 54     public Object get(Object obj) throws IllegalArgumentException {
 55         return Float.valueOf(getFloat(obj));
 56     }
 57 
 58     public boolean getBoolean(Object obj) throws IllegalArgumentException {
 59         throw newGetBooleanIllegalArgumentException();
 60     }
 61 
 62     public byte getByte(Object obj) throws IllegalArgumentException {
 63         throw newGetByteIllegalArgumentException();
 64     }
 65 
 66     public char getChar(Object obj) throws IllegalArgumentException {
 67         throw newGetCharIllegalArgumentException();
 68     }
 69 
 70     public short getShort(Object obj) throws IllegalArgumentException {
 71         throw newGetShortIllegalArgumentException();
 72     }
 73 
 74     public int getInt(Object obj) throws IllegalArgumentException {
 75         throw newGetIntIllegalArgumentException();
 76     }
 77 
 78     public long getLong(Object obj) throws IllegalArgumentException {
 79         throw newGetLongIllegalArgumentException();
 80     }
 81 
 82     public float getFloat(Object obj) throws IllegalArgumentException {
 83         try {
 84             if (isStatic()) {
 85                 return (float) getter.invokeExact();
 86             } else {
 87                 return (float) getter.invokeExact(obj);
 88             }
 89         } catch (IllegalArgumentException|IllegalStateException|NullPointerException e) {
 90             throw e;
 91         } catch (ClassCastException e) {
 92             throw newGetIllegalArgumentException(obj);
 93         } catch (Throwable e) {
 94             throw new InternalError(e);
 95         }
 96     }
 97 
 98     public double getDouble(Object obj) throws IllegalArgumentException {
 99         return getFloat(obj);
100     }
101 
102     public void set(Object obj, Object value)
103             throws IllegalArgumentException, IllegalAccessException
104     {
105         ensureObj(obj);
106         if (isReadOnly()) {
107             throwFinalFieldIllegalAccessException(value);
108         }
109 
110         if (value == null) {
111             throwSetIllegalArgumentException(value);
112         }
113 
114         if (value instanceof Byte b) {
115             setFloat(obj, b.byteValue());
116         }
117         else if (value instanceof Short s) {
118             setFloat(obj, s.shortValue());
119         }
120         else if (value instanceof Character c) {
121             setFloat(obj, c.charValue());
122         }
123         else if (value instanceof Integer i) {
124             setFloat(obj, i.intValue());
125         }
126         else if (value instanceof Long l) {
127             setFloat(obj, l.longValue());
128         }
129         else if (value instanceof Float f) {
130             setFloat(obj, f.floatValue());
131         }
132         else {
133             throwSetIllegalArgumentException(value);
134         }
135     }
136 
137     public void setBoolean(Object obj, boolean z)
138         throws IllegalArgumentException, IllegalAccessException
139     {
140         throwSetIllegalArgumentException(z);
141     }
142 
143     public void setByte(Object obj, byte b)
144         throws IllegalArgumentException, IllegalAccessException
145     {
146         setFloat(obj, b);
147     }
148 
149     public void setChar(Object obj, char c)
150         throws IllegalArgumentException, IllegalAccessException
151     {
152         setFloat(obj, c);
153     }
154 
155     public void setShort(Object obj, short s)
156         throws IllegalArgumentException, IllegalAccessException
157     {
158         setFloat(obj, s);
159     }
160 
161     public void setInt(Object obj, int i)
162         throws IllegalArgumentException, IllegalAccessException
163     {
164         setFloat(obj, i);
165     }
166 
167     public void setLong(Object obj, long l)
168         throws IllegalArgumentException, IllegalAccessException
169     {
170         setFloat(obj, l);
171     }
172 
173     public void setFloat(Object obj, float f)
174         throws IllegalArgumentException, IllegalAccessException
175     {
176         if (isReadOnly()) {
177             ensureObj(obj);     // throw NPE if obj is null on instance field
178             throwFinalFieldIllegalAccessException(f);
179         }
180         try {
181             if (isStatic()) {
182                 setter.invokeExact(f);
183             } else {
184                 setter.invokeExact(obj, f);
185             }
186         } catch (IllegalArgumentException|IllegalStateException|NullPointerException e) {
187             throw e;
188         } catch (ClassCastException e) {
189             // receiver is of invalid type
190             throw newSetIllegalArgumentException(obj);
191         } catch (Throwable e) {
192             throw new InternalError(e);
193         }
194     }
195 
196     public void setDouble(Object obj, double d)
197         throws IllegalArgumentException, IllegalAccessException
198     {
199         throwSetIllegalArgumentException(d);
200     }
201 }
